It was originally moated, and probably timber-framed before being rebuilt in brick. It was associated with the medieval order of the Knights Hospitaller (later the Order of St John of Jerusalem) in the 1400s. The house was subdivided among poor tenants, among them chimney sweeps, in the 18th century before being demolished in the early 19th century.\r\n\r\nThis object was part of the John Edmund Gardner collection of topographical prints and drawings of London. After Gardner's death the collection passed to his son Edmund Thomas, but was sold to Edward Coates MP in 1910. The collection was sold again in 1923 after Coates' death, and was split between various institutions and private collectors. The portion connected with Hoxton, Homerton, Hackney and Bethnal Green was bought by the Hon. Arthur Villiers and donated to the Bethnal Green Museum.
